WordPress Donation Plugin for Schools and Parent Associations

School fundraising

WordPress Donation Plugin for Schools and Parent Associations

Schools, parent associations and student organizations regularly raise funds online: for equipment, events, field trips, projects and community needs. This guide shows how to collect contributions through your WordPress website with FundCollector, a WordPress donation plugin, without relying on third-party platforms that take fees or require donors to create accounts.

Common fundraising needs for schools

The fundraising needs of a school or parent association tend to be specific and often time-limited. Common examples include:

  • Equipment purchases (tablets, sports gear, musical instruments)
  • Field trips and educational experiences
  • Library or classroom resource funds
  • Annual fundraising drives (spring fairs, Christmas events)
  • Support for individual families in need, handled by the association
  • Scholarships or bursary funds

These campaigns are typically short (weeks to a few months), have a clear goal amount, and are promoted through school newsletters, email lists and parent messaging apps. The donation page needs to communicate the goal clearly and show progress when possible.

What a school donation page should include

A donation page for a school fundraiser should leave no ambiguity about who is collecting the money and what it will be used for. Include:

  • The name of the school or association
  • A clear description of the campaign goal
  • The specific amount being raised and what it covers
  • A deadline if the campaign is time-limited
  • Contact information for the association (not individual names if privacy is a concern)
  • A privacy note explaining how donor data is handled

Parents and community members who donate to a school fund are usually motivated by a clear, specific need rather than a general appeal. “Help us buy 20 tablets for the computer lab – we need 2,000” is far more effective than “Support our school”.

Privacy considerations for school fundraising

Schools operate under stricter privacy requirements than most organizations, particularly regarding minors. When running a donation campaign, the data you collect is from adults (parents, family members, community supporters) rather than from students, which simplifies the GDPR picture considerably.

You should still:

  • Include a privacy notice on the donation form explaining what data is collected and how it is used.
  • Store donor data securely inside WordPress rather than in unprotected spreadsheets.
  • Not share the donor list with third parties.
  • Provide a way for donors to request deletion of their data.

A donation plugin that stores records inside WordPress and does not send data to external services (beyond the payment gateway) makes GDPR compliance easier to manage. See the GDPR-compliant donation forms guide for a full overview.

Parent associations and informal groups

Many parent associations and school support groups are informal entities without a registered legal structure. This does not prevent them from collecting donations on WordPress, but it does affect how the donation page should be presented.

Be transparent about the legal status of the collecting entity. If the association is not a registered charity, avoid language that implies tax deductibility. State clearly who the funds go to and who is responsible for them. This honesty builds trust rather than undermining it.

A WordPress donation plugin for an informal association works the same way as for a registered nonprofit: install the plugin, create the form, connect PayPal or bank transfer, and embed the form on a page. The difference is only in how you describe the organization on the page itself.

Payment methods that work for schools

PayPal is a safe default for school fundraising because most parents already have a PayPal account or are comfortable with the PayPal checkout interface. Card payments via PayPal (which does not require a PayPal account) cover donors who prefer direct card entry.

Bank transfer is worth offering alongside PayPal, particularly for larger contributions or for donors who prefer not to use online payment services. Clear bank transfer instructions on the donation form reduce the friction for this group.

A combination of PayPal (including cards) and bank transfer covers nearly every potential donor in a school community.

School fundraising works best when it is simple

A school donation campaign does not need an elaborate platform. A clear page, a specific goal, a short donation form and one or two payment methods is enough. The more straightforward the process, the more likely busy parents are to complete it.

FundCollector, a free WordPress donation plugin, is available on WordPress.org and includes PayPal, bank transfer, donor records and confirmation emails. It is well suited to schools and informal associations that need a simple, privacy-conscious donation setup without ongoing fees.